今天給各位分享css3概念的知識,其中也會對進(jìn)行解釋,如果能碰巧解決你現(xiàn)在面臨的問題,別忘了關(guān)注本站,現(xiàn)在開始吧!
本文目錄一覽:
- 1、CSS3伸縮布局
- 2、想學(xué)web前端需要學(xué)什么知識
- 3、零基礎(chǔ)學(xué)web前端難度多大
- 4、css3中的漸進(jìn)增強(qiáng)和優(yōu)雅降級如何使用
- 5、css3中-moz、-ms、-webkit各什么意思
- 6、前端開發(fā)需要學(xué)什么啊?
CSS3伸縮布局
伸縮布局是彈性布局的伸縮項目。伸縮布局是一種CSS3的新布局方式,又叫彈性布局,他是彈性布局的伸縮項目。彈性布局(彈性伸縮布局)事實(shí)上它是一種新類型的盒子模型,也有書上稱作彈性伸縮盒布局。
flex是flexinle BOX的縮寫。意思是彈性布局,用來為盒模型提供最大的靈活性。 任何一個容器(標(biāo)簽)都可以指定為flex布局。
這種布局方式是通過css3新增的一些輔助布局的樣式屬性來制作布局的方式。rem布局 rem是一種相對長度單位,通過這個長度單位可以實(shí)現(xiàn)元素寬高等比例縮放,從而完成不同寬度屏幕的適配。
主要檢測寬度),并設(shè)置不同的CSS樣式,就可以實(shí)現(xiàn)響應(yīng)式的布局。主要依靠是css的媒體查詢。注:每個屏幕分辨率下面會有一個布局樣式,即元素位置和大小都會變。
想學(xué)web前端需要學(xué)什么知識
JavaScript:學(xué)習(xí)JavaScript語言,它是一種高級編程語言,用于創(chuàng)建交互式網(wǎng)頁和動態(tài)Web應(yīng)用程序。響應(yīng)式Web設(shè)計:學(xué)習(xí)如何創(chuàng)建可以適應(yīng)不同屏幕大小和設(shè)備的網(wǎng)頁。
Web前端開發(fā)需要學(xué)習(xí)的知識包括但不限于以下幾個方面:HTML、CSS、JavaScript:這是Web前端開發(fā)的基礎(chǔ),需要掌握HTML標(biāo)記語言、CSS樣式表以及JavaScript腳本語言的基本語法和常用特性。
Web前端開發(fā)環(huán)境,HTML常用標(biāo)簽,表單元素,Table布局,CSS樣式表,DIV+CSS布局。熟練運(yùn)用HTML和CSS樣式屬性完成頁面的布局和美化,能夠仿制任意網(wǎng)站的前端頁面實(shí)現(xiàn)。
學(xué)WEB前端都需要學(xué)些什么呢?一起來看看吧:html+css+js,是WEB前端開發(fā)最基礎(chǔ)的知識。JQuery、html5+csshttp+ajax+json+nodejs+mysql+mongoDB等前后端交互、vue、react、小程序、app混合開發(fā)等進(jìn)階知識。
第一:Web前端開發(fā)知識。Web前端開發(fā)的基礎(chǔ)知識包括三方面內(nèi)容,分別是Html、CSS和JavaScript,其中JavaScript是一個學(xué)習(xí)的重點(diǎn),也是一個難點(diǎn)。
web前端培訓(xùn)學(xué)習(xí)課程包括三個部分:基礎(chǔ)部分、設(shè)計部分和代碼部分,包括CSS、HTML、Ajax、JavaScript等編程語言。想要進(jìn)行web前端培訓(xùn)推薦【達(dá)內(nèi)教育】,該機(jī)構(gòu)與多家企業(yè)簽訂人才培養(yǎng)協(xié)議,全面助力學(xué)員更好的就業(yè)。
零基礎(chǔ)學(xué)web前端難度多大
Web前端開發(fā)雖然技術(shù)難度并不高,但是技術(shù)細(xì)節(jié)卻比較多,內(nèi)容也比較雜。Web前端的基礎(chǔ)包括三大部分,包括Html、CSS和JavaScript,其中JavaScript是學(xué)習(xí)的重點(diǎn),也是難點(diǎn)。另外,vue等框架也是需要熟練掌握的。
前端開發(fā)的語法比較簡單,實(shí)驗環(huán)境也好搭建,對于零基礎(chǔ)的人來說,學(xué)前端開發(fā)并不是很難。不過,前端開發(fā)雖然入門簡單,但是后期要學(xué)的內(nèi)容越來越多,越來越深,要經(jīng)過長時間的學(xué)習(xí)和大量的練習(xí),才能熟練掌握技術(shù)。
學(xué)習(xí)web前端開發(fā)不難。零基礎(chǔ)也能學(xué)會。不過要找一個靠譜的專業(yè)培訓(xùn)機(jī)構(gòu)。千鋒教育就很不錯,師資力量、教學(xué)環(huán)境、教學(xué)質(zhì)量都獲眾多學(xué)員的一致好評!學(xué)習(xí)WEB前端的入門要點(diǎn):html+css+js,是WEB前端開發(fā)最基礎(chǔ)的知識。
web前端開發(fā)學(xué)習(xí)入門web前端并不難,難的是課程是否學(xué)精學(xué)深。感興趣的話點(diǎn)擊此處,免費(fèi)學(xué)習(xí)一下如果真的想要從事前端開發(fā)、想要拿到高薪,參加專業(yè)學(xué)習(xí)是一個非常不錯的選擇。
css3中的漸進(jìn)增強(qiáng)和優(yōu)雅降級如何使用
如果你采用漸進(jìn)增強(qiáng)的開發(fā)流程,先做一個基本功能版,然后針對各個瀏覽器進(jìn)行漸進(jìn)增加,增加各種功能。相對于優(yōu)雅降級來說,開發(fā)周期長,初期投入資金大。
優(yōu)雅降級需要正確地體現(xiàn)HTML標(biāo)簽的語義,符合“瀏覽器的預(yù)期”。讓你的網(wǎng)頁在各種情況—下——包括降級(javascript被禁用,css傳輸失敗等等)的情形都可以運(yùn)作良好。這是我理解的優(yōu)雅降級的意義。
同樣以css為例,優(yōu)雅降級的寫法如下。漸進(jìn)增強(qiáng),開發(fā)時間長,成本高,優(yōu)雅降級,節(jié)約成本,開發(fā)周期短。
因此也應(yīng)運(yùn)而生很多CSSHack來解決這些Bug,多數(shù)CSSHack都是用來解決IE5以下瀏覽器的。因為瀏覽器的支持度問題,網(wǎng)站又分為了漸進(jìn)增強(qiáng)和優(yōu)雅降級兩種開發(fā)方式。
css3中-moz、-ms、-webkit各什么意思
-webkie-是谷歌和蘋果瀏覽器的前綴,-ms-是ie的前綴,和火狐、歐朋沒有關(guān)系啊,它們內(nèi)核不一樣。
代表是各瀏覽器內(nèi)核的兼容寫法。有時候有些css樣式需要考慮不同內(nèi)核瀏覽器的兼容性和顯示效果,會在樣式前面加個前綴。
以樓主貼出的代碼為例,前綴-webkit表示這適用于webkit內(nèi)核的瀏覽器,-moz是火狐,-ms的是IE的,最后一段是原型代碼。這4段其實(shí)是對4種瀏覽器的兼容,后面turn就是這個動畫里面關(guān)鍵幀的名字(animation-name)。
前端開發(fā)需要學(xué)什么啊?
學(xué)習(xí)HTML+CSS搭建網(wǎng)頁、CSS動畫特效、PhotoShop切圖等基礎(chǔ)知識,獲得初級Web前端工程師技能,主要進(jìn)行PC端網(wǎng)頁制作與樣式設(shè)計實(shí)現(xiàn),能夠配合UI設(shè)計師進(jìn)行項目開發(fā)。
web前端需要學(xué)HTML、CSS、JavaScript、jQuery、Ajax、前端框架(vue/React/Angular等)等前端知識;還要了解每個瀏覽器中的各個版本的兼容性、Web標(biāo)準(zhǔn)、移動設(shè)備、多終端適配等知識。
前端開發(fā)需要學(xué)習(xí)的內(nèi)容包括PC網(wǎng)站布局、HTML5+CSS3基礎(chǔ)項目、webapp頁面布局等。學(xué)習(xí)web前端開發(fā),web開發(fā)工具有frontpage,可以使用word讓人輕松學(xué)習(xí)frontpage,另一個常見的是Dreamweaver,這兩個是最常用的HTML網(wǎng)頁制作工具。
關(guān)于css3概念和的介紹到此就結(jié)束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關(guān)注本站。